10-Day Scenic Journey Through Austria and Switzerland: Culture, Nature, and Culinary Delights

Day 1: Vienna Exploration
Vienna, Austria on April 15, 2025
8:00AM
Breakfast at Café Central
Begin your day with a traditional Viennese breakfast at the iconic Café Central, known for its elegant atmosphere and delicious pastries.
EUR15, 1 hour
9:30AM
Visit Schönbrunn Palace
Tour the stunning Schönbrunn Palace, the former imperial summer residence, featuring beautiful gardens and opulent rooms. Open from 8:30AM to 5:30PM.
EUR22, 2 hours
12:00PM
Lunch at Naschmarkt
Enjoy diverse culinary delights at Naschmarkt, Vienna’s famous open-air market with numerous food stalls offering Austrian and international flavours.
EUR20, 1 hour
1:30PM
St. Stephen’s Cathedral and City Centre Walk
Explore the iconic St. Stephen’s Cathedral and stroll through Vienna’s historic city centre to admire architecture and charming streets.
Free, 1.5 hours
3:30PM
Visit Belvedere Palace
Discover art masterpieces including Gustav Klimt’s 'The Kiss' at the Belvedere Palace. The palace is open until 6:00PM.
EUR16, 1.5 hours
7:00PM
Dinner at Figlmüller
Savour the famous Wiener schnitzel at Figlmüller, a renowned traditional Viennese restaurant near the city centre.
EUR30, 1.5 hours
Find Hotels in Vienna
Day 2: Salzburg Sightseeing
Salzburg, Austria on April 16, 2025
7:30AM
Train to Salzburg
Take an early train from Vienna to Salzburg, a scenic 2.5-hour journey through the Austrian countryside.
EUR45, 2.5 hours
10:30AM
Breakfast at Café Tomaselli
Enjoy a light breakfast at Café Tomaselli, Salzburg’s oldest coffee house with delightful cakes and coffees.
EUR12, 1 hour
11:30AM
Hohensalzburg Fortress
Visit the impressive Hohensalzburg Fortress offering panoramic views of Salzburg; open from 9:30AM to 5:00PM.
EUR16, 2 hours
2:00PM
Lunch at St. Peter Stiftskulinarium
Dine in one of Europe’s oldest restaurants, serving traditional Austrian dishes in a historic setting.
EUR30, 1.5 hours
4:00PM
Mozart’s Birthplace Museum
Explore the museum dedicated to Wolfgang Amadeus Mozart, showcasing his life and works. It closes at 5:30PM.
EUR12, 1 hour
6:00PM
Dinner at Gasthof Goldgasse
Experience a cozy dinner with local Austrian cuisine in Salzburg’s Old Town.
EUR25, 1.5 hours
Find Hotels in Salzburg
Day 3: Lucerne Arrival and Exploration
Lucerne, Switzerland on April 17, 2025
7:00AM
Train from Salzburg to Lucerne
Travel by train to Lucerne, Switzerland with a transfer in Zurich, total duration around 5 hours.
CHF60, 5 hours
12:30PM
Lunch at Wirtshaus Galliker
Relish traditional Swiss dishes at this local eatery, known for its warm atmosphere and authentic flavours.
CHF25, 1 hour
2:00PM
Explore Chapel Bridge and Old Town
Walk along Lucerne’s famous wooden Chapel Bridge and explore the charming Old Town with its historic buildings and murals.
Free, 2 hours
4:30PM
Visit the Swiss Museum of Transport
An extensive museum focusing on all forms of transport and mobility, open until 5:00PM on weekdays.
CHF32, 1 hour
7:00PM
Dinner at Stadtkeller Swiss Folklore Restaurant
Enjoy a traditional Swiss Alpine atmosphere with folklore music and dishes like fondue or raclette.
CHF40, 1.5 hours
Find Hotels in Lucerne
Day 4: Interlaken and Lauterbrunnen
Interlaken, Switzerland on April 18, 2025
8:00AM
Train to Interlaken
Short train journey from Lucerne to Interlaken, about 2 hours, passing scenic views of lakes and mountains.
CHF30, 2 hours
10:30AM
Breakfast at Café Oberland
Start with a hearty breakfast in Interlaken’s central café, specializing in Swiss and European breakfast classics.
CHF18, 1 hour
11:30AM
Visit Harder Kulm
Take the funicular to Harder Kulm for breathtaking views over Interlaken and surrounding alpine scenery. Open daily 9:00AM to 7:00PM.
CHF38, 2 hours
2:00PM
Lunch at Restaurant Laterne
Dine on traditional Swiss dishes in a cozy setting in Interlaken’s town centre.
CHF25, 1 hour
3:30PM
Visit Lauterbrunnen Valley
Short train ride to Lauterbrunnen to explore stunning waterfalls and alpine landscapes on foot; the valley is open year-round.
Train CHF8, 3 hours
7:00PM
Dinner back in Interlaken at Husi Bierhaus
Enjoy hearty food with Swiss beers in a laid-back atmosphere in Interlaken.
CHF35, 1.5 hours
Find Hotels in Interlaken
Day 5: Zermatt and the Matterhorn
Zermatt, Switzerland on April 19, 2025
8:00AM
Train to Zermatt
Travel from Interlaken to Zermatt by scenic train ride approximately 2.5 hours. No cars allowed in Zermatt.
CHF40, 2.5 hours
11:00AM
Breakfast at Biner
Enjoy fresh Swiss baked goods and coffee at Biner, a local favourite bakery in Zermatt.
CHF15, 45 minutes
12:00PM
Gornergrat Railway Ride
Take the cogwheel train to Gornergrat for spectacular views of the Matterhorn and the surrounding Alps. Open 8:00AM to 7:00PM.
CHF95, 3 hours
3:30PM
Lunch at Restaurant Schäferstube
Taste traditional Valais dishes like raclette and dried meats in a charming mountain restaurant.
CHF30, 1.5 hours
6:00PM
Evening walk in Zermatt village
Stroll around Zermatt’s picturesque pedestrian village, enjoying mountain village charm and shops.
Free, 1 hour
7:30PM
Dinner at The Omnia
Dine in style at The Omnia, offering modern cuisine with stunning mountain views.
CHF60, 2 hours
Find Hotels in Zermatt
Day 6: Zurich City Highlights
Zurich, Switzerland on April 20, 2025
8:00AM
Train to Zurich
Travel from Zermatt to Zurich by train, approximately 3.5 hours.
CHF50, 3.5 hours
12:00PM
Lunch at Zeughauskeller
Enjoy traditional Swiss fare in a historic armory building in Zurich’s city centre.
CHF28, 1 hour
1:30PM
Explore Old Town (Altstadt)
Walk through Zurich’s Old Town with its narrow streets, historical buildings, and shops.
Free, 2 hours
3:30PM
Visit Kunsthaus Zurich
Explore one of Switzerland's premier art museums featuring classic and contemporary works. Open 10:00AM to 6:00PM.
CHF23, 1.5 hours
7:00PM
Dinner at Hiltl
Dine at the world’s oldest vegetarian restaurant, Hiltl, offering diverse and delicious cuisine.
CHF35, 1.5 hours
Find Hotels in Zurich
Day 7: Day Trip to Rhine Falls and Stein am Rhein
Zurich, Switzerland on April 21, 2025
8:00AM
Train to Rhine Falls
Take a train to Schaffhausen and then a short bus ride to Rhine Falls, Europe’s largest waterfall.
CHF20, 1.5 hours
9:30AM
Visit Rhine Falls
Enjoy the spectacular views and boat trips close to the waterfall. Opens from 9:00AM to 6:00PM.
CHF7, 2 hours
11:30AM
Train to Stein am Rhein
Short train ride to the picturesque medieval town of Stein am Rhein known for its beautifully painted houses.
CHF10, 30 minutes
12:00PM
Lunch at Gasthof Hirschen
Enjoy traditional Swiss-German cuisine in the historic centre of Stein am Rhein.
CHF25, 1 hour
1:30PM
Explore Stein am Rhein
Stroll through this well-preserved medieval town, visiting local shops and the town museum.
Museum CHF8, 2 hours
4:00PM
Return to Zurich
Travel back to Zurich by train to relax for the evening.
CHF20, 1.5 hours
7:30PM
Dinner at Swiss Chuchi Restaurant
End your day with authentic Swiss fondue in Zurich’s Old Town.
CHF40, 1.5 hours
Find Hotels in Zurich
Day 8: Lake Lucerne and Mount Pilatus
Lucerne, Switzerland on April 22, 2025
7:30AM
Train to Lucerne
Return to Lucerne from Zurich, approximately 1 hour by train.
CHF25, 1 hour
8:30AM
Breakfast at Café Bar Restaurant Rathaus Brauerei
Enjoy breakfast and locally brewed beer at this brewery and restaurant near the lake.
CHF18, 1 hour
9:45AM
Boat Trip on Lake Lucerne
Take a scenic boat cruise on Lake Lucerne to Alpnachstad, enjoying stunning mountain views. Boat operates from 9:00AM to 5:00PM.
CHF30, 1.5 hours
11:30AM
Mount Pilatus Cable Car
From Alpnachstad, take the world’s steepest cogwheel railway to Pilatus or cable car from Kriens. Open 8:30AM to 5:00PM.
CHF75, 3 hours
3:30PM
Return to Lucerne
Descend and return by boat or train to Lucerne for a relaxed afternoon.
Included, 1.5 hours
7:00PM
Dinner at Restaurant Balances
Dine by the riverside with modern Swiss cuisine and beautiful views of the Old Town Bridges.
CHF50, 2 hours
Find Hotels in Lucerne
Day 9: Bern and Emmental Highlights
Bern, Switzerland on April 23, 2025
7:30AM
Train to Bern
Travel from Lucerne to Bern, the capital city of Switzerland, around 1 hour by train.
CHF30, 1 hour
8:45AM
Breakfast at Café Fédéral
Enjoy a classic Swiss breakfast in this café located in Bern’s historic center.
CHF18, 1 hour
9:45AM
Explore Bern Old Town
Walk through Bern’s UNESCO-listed medieval center, visit the Zytglogge clock tower and Bear Park.
Free, 2.5 hours
12:30PM
Lunch at Restaurant Kornhauskeller
Lunch in a stunning cellar setting serving traditional and modern Swiss cuisine.
CHF30, 1 hour
2:00PM
Visit Emmental Cheese Dairy
Short trip to Emmental to visit a cheese dairy and learn about the famous Emmental cheese making process. Confirm opening times (usually until 4:30PM).
CHF20, 2 hours
5:00PM
Return to Bern
Travel back to Bern to relax and prepare for dinner.
Included, 30 minutes
7:00PM
Dinner at Altes Tramdepot
Enjoy great beer brewed onsite and a variety of Swiss dishes in a lively brewery-restaurant.
CHF35, 1.5 hours
Find Hotels in Bern
Day 10: Departure from Zurich
Zurich, Switzerland on April 24, 2025
8:00AM
Travel to Zurich Airport
Head to Zurich Airport by train or taxi for your onward international flight.
CHF10, 1 hour
9:00AM
Breakfast at Zurich Airport
Enjoy a relaxed breakfast at one of the airport lounges or cafés before departure.
CHF20, 1 hour
